A statistical blunder refers to an error or mistake in the collection, analysis, or interpretation of data that leads to misleading conclusions. This can occur due to various factors, such as improper sampling methods, miscalculations, or overlooking confounding variables. Such blunders can severely impact research findings and decision-making. Recognizing and correcting these errors is essential for maintaining the integrity of statistical analysis.
